]> git.baikalelectronics.ru Git - kernel.git/commit
[ARM] pxa: fix the corgi_ssp.c dependency issue in {corgi,spitz}_defconfig
authorEric Miao <eric.miao@marvell.com>
Tue, 21 Oct 2008 03:36:19 +0000 (11:36 +0800)
committerEric Miao <eric.miao@marvell.com>
Tue, 21 Oct 2008 03:36:19 +0000 (11:36 +0800)
commita26f975f923838589169a5812c6e9850720dfefc
treecfeab1d0b8f4ab18db71feb406ef2b510c08e452
parent5b8f352002d08edcba1dab01c5c99121de874aa8
[ARM] pxa: fix the corgi_ssp.c dependency issue in {corgi,spitz}_defconfig

Separate building of corgi_ssp.c, and introduce a new hidden config option
CONFIG_CORGI_SSP_DEPRECATED for this. Aslo mark corgi_ts.c and corgi_bl.c
as deprecated.

This unbreaks the legacy configs in {corgi,spitz}_defconfig, however, SPI
based ADS7846 touchscreen driver and a new SPI-based corgi_lcd.c driver
with integrated backlight support are recommended.

Signed-off-by: Eric Miao <eric.miao@marvell.com>
arch/arm/mach-pxa/Kconfig
arch/arm/mach-pxa/Makefile
arch/arm/mach-pxa/corgi_lcd.c
arch/arm/mach-pxa/sharpsl_pm.c
drivers/input/touchscreen/Kconfig
drivers/video/backlight/Kconfig